Embarking on a new romantic journey can be both exhilarating and nerve - wracking for dating novices. Interactive mini - games offer a fun and effective way to break the ice, build rapport, and deepen the connection between two people.

In the initial stages of dating, there is often a sense of awkwardness and uncertainty. Many new couples struggle to find common ground and have meaningful conversations. This is where interactive mini - games come into play. They provide a structured and light - hearted environment where both parties can relax and get to know each other better.

One of the simplest yet most effective mini - games is the Two Truths and a Lie. Each person takes turns sharing two true statements and one false statement about themselves. The other person then has to guess which one is the lie. This game not only reveals interesting facts about each other but also encourages active listening and critical thinking. For example, if one person says, I've climbed Mount Fuji, I can play the violin, and I once met a famous actor, the other can engage in a lively discussion while trying to figure out the lie.

Another great game is Would You Rather. Present a series of two - option questions, such as Would you rather travel to the future or the past? or Would you rather have a superpower of invisibility or flight? This game allows both partners to understand each other's values, preferences, and perspectives. It can lead to in - depth conversations and help uncover shared interests.

To make the most of these interactive mini - games, new couples should set aside dedicated time during their dates. They can also customize the games based on their interests. For instance, if both are movie buffs, they can create movie - themed Would You Rather questions. Additionally, it's important to approach these games with a positive and open - minded attitude, as the goal is to have fun and build a stronger connection.
